✦ Synopsis
A CNN Universal Machine-based structure and analogic algorithm is proposed to extract 3D spatial information from stereo images. The CNN template values are obtained in two ways: from simplex optimization and from the energy function. The method is demonstrated on densely textured as well as grey scale stereograms.
